Established in 2009 under the leadership of Dr. Gary Davison, Lambert High School is dedicated to providing students with an exceptional educational experience. We are located at the intersection of Old Atlanta Highway and Nichols Road in Suwanee, Georgia, serving the south end of Forsyth County.

Our school is named in honor of Mr. Clarence Lambert, who dedicated many years of service to Forsyth County Schools. We are proud to carry on his legacy of commitment to education.

As a school for grades 9 through 12, we offer a wide range of academic courses, including numerous Advanced Placement (AP) classes. Students have the opportunity to get involved in a variety of clubs, activities, and sports. Our sports teams compete in the 6A classification.
